Buying Tips

When purchasing land in Outside Area (outside U.s.) Foreign Country, it's vital to prioritize due diligence. First, ensure you carefully examine zoning regulations for your intended use, as these can significantly impact what can be built on the property. Working with a local real estate agent who specializes in land transactions can provide valuable insights into the nuances of the market and help navigate the legal landscape. Additionally, consider the proximity of amenities such as schools, transportation, and parks, as these factors can enhance your lifestyle and property value. Visiting the land multiple times at different times of day will give you a more comprehensive understanding of the neighborhood's dynamics. Lastly, don't overlook the importance of a thorough land survey to identify property boundaries and any potential issues that might arise during development.
